  • How to make a Shared Mailbox forward emails to multiple users
    To forward emails from a shared mailbox to multiple persons in Microsoft 365 without using a distribution list, you'll need to set up a mail flow rule directly in the Exchange admin center. This rule will forward incoming emails to the shared mailbox to the specified recipients. Here's how to do it: Step-by-Step Guide to Set Up Email Forwarding via Mail Flow Rules Step 1: Access Exchange Admin Center Log in to the Microsoft 365 admin center with your admin account.   • How to Delete Guest users in Microsoft 365
    What are Guest Users in Office 365? Guest users refer to individuals from outside your organization granted access to certain Office 365 services. These users typically do not hold positions such as employee, contractor, or full-time member within your organization. However, they require access to Office 365 resources like email, SharePoint documents, Microsoft Teams, and calendars.   • How to let your Microsoft Partner bypass Conditional Access Policies to help you support your Tenant
    How to let your Microsoft Partner bypass Conditional Access Policies to help you support your Tenant Background Microsoft has heard and understands the need for Service Providers to have access to customer tenants to provide support. Because of the DAP to GDAP transition, Microsoft has released the ability to exclude Service Providers from Conditional Access Policies.
